How to install

  1. Create a restore point(Start → "Create a restore point" → Create), so you can roll back if anything goes wrong.
  2. Verify compatibility: your Windows version (Windows 8) and architecture (x64, x86)must match this driver, and your device's Hardware ID should appear in the list above.
  3. Download the file using the button - it comes directly from Microsoft Update Catalog.
  4. Optionally verify the checksum: open PowerShell, run Get-FileHash your-download.cab -Algorithm SHA256 and compare with the SHA-256 above.
  5. Extract the .cab archive: right-click → Extract All, or run expand -F:* file.cab C:\driver\ in Command Prompt.
  6. Install via Device Manager: right-click your device → Update driver → Browse my computer → point to the extracted folder. Alternatively run pnputil /add-driver C:\driver\*.inf /install.
  7. Check Device Manager: the device should show no warning icons, and the driver version should match.

How to roll back

If the device stops working after the update: Device Manager → right-click the device → Properties → Driver tab → Roll Back Driver. If the button is greyed out, use the restore point from step 1 (Start → "Recovery" → Open System Restore).
